一、安装
(1)、第一步:官网下载
8.0版本无需安装,直接解压.zip压缩包即可,以下将具体介绍




(2)第二步:进入下载完成后解压到除c盘以外的盘,如下图所示:例如解压到D:盘
(3) 第三步:新建文本文档,将txt格式修改为.ini格式:首先点击查看,勾选文件扩展名,右键查看属性将.txt后缀修改为.ini



(4)第四步:my.ini配置文件内容如下:
[mysqld]
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=D:\appdata\mysql-8.0.22-winx64
# 设置mysql数据库的数据的存放目录
datadir=E:\ds\work\mysql\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。
max_connect_errors=10
# 服务端使用的字符集默认为utf8mb4
character-set-server=utf8mb4
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用“mysql_native_password”插件认证
default_authentication_plugin=mysql_native_password
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8mb4
[client]
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8mb4
(5)第五步:初始化MySQL,在安装时,避免权限问题出错我们尽量使用管理员身份运行CMD,否则在安装时会报错,会导致安装失败的情况,如下图所示


打开后进入mysql的bin目录,输入 cd +空格+你的路径 ,如下图所示:

(6)第六步:安装(前提是之前没安装过mysql,若安装过,下面有介绍卸载方式;若不知道有没有安装可以可以在cmd窗口输入services.msc查看有没有mysql服务),以管理员身份进入命令提示符 ,进入 mysql-8.0.22-winx64/bin 目录下。先初始化 mysqld --initialize --console,然后安装 mysqld install。

若按上述操作无法正常安装,且提示错误为缺少dll文件,可能是你的计算机缺少必要的Microsoft Visual C++,可以到官网下载最新版,网上也有收集vc++的常用版本,也可以去下载。

安装MySQL服务,输入 mysqld --install [服务名](服务名可以不加默认为mysql) ,如下图所示:

(7)第七步:服务安装成功之后输入 net start mysql(启动MySQL的服务) ,如下图所示:

(8)第八步:登录验证,mysql是否安装成功!(要注意上面产生的随机密码,不包括前面符号前面的空格,否则会登陆失败),如果和下图所示一样,则说明你的mysql已经安装成功!注意,,一定要先开启服务,不然会登陆失败,出现拒绝访问的提示符!!!

(9)第九步:修改密码:由于初始化产生的随机密码太复杂,,不便于我们登录mysql,因此,我们应当修改一个自己能记住的密码!!

再次登录验证新密码:

(10)第十步:设置系统的全局变量:
为了方便登录操作mysql,在这里我们设置一个全局变量:↓
①点击"我的电脑"-->"属性"-->''高级系统设置''-->''环境变量'',接下来如下图所操作

②把新建的mysql变量添加到Path路径变量中,点击确定,即完成:

配置完成之后,每当我们想要用命令行使用mysql时,只需要win+R,-->输入"cmd"打开命令行,之后输入登录sql语句即可。
(11)第十一步:连接MySQL,我用Navicat来展示,如下图所示:




这样就可以使用MySQL了
本文提供MySQL 8.0版本的详细安装步骤,涵盖下载、配置、初始化及服务安装等内容,并指导如何通过命令行登录验证及修改密码。

2043

被折叠的 条评论
为什么被折叠?



